Key Drop Deliveries Sample Clauses

Key Drop Deliveries. Distributor may, upon the prior written approval of an officer of the Participant (or other appropriate level employee of the Retail Outlet) which approval shall not be unreasonably withheld, or as provided on the applicable Brand Exhibit(s), deliver Products: (A) when the Retail Outlet is closed; or (B) at such additional times that the applicable Participant designates in writing for a key drop delivery (each a “Key Drop Delivery”). If Distributor’s driver sets off an alarm at a Key Drop Delivery (other than because Participant did not provide the correct alarm code or due to an alarm malfunction) and there are charges incurred by the Participant as a result of such alarm, Distributor shall reimburse the applicable Participant for such charges. If a Participant changes the key to the delivery door and/or alarm code, the Participant must provide the new key and/or alarm code prior to the Participant’s next order leaving the distribution center. If Distributor is unable to access a Retail Outlet because Distributor was not provided the new key and/or alarm code prior to the Participant’s next order leaving the distribution center, Distributor may omit delivery of that order and promptly work directly with the Participant to redeliver that order as soon as reasonably possible at the redelivery rate mutually agreed upon by Distributor and the Participant. Key Drop Deliveries must be completed before the Retail Outlet opens for business to be considered a “Key Drop Delivery” and shorts and damages must be called into Distributor by 11:00 a.m. the next business day following such Key Drop Delivery to qualify for credit from Distributor. Products shall be deemed delivered when actually placed in the appropriate storage areas of the Retail Outlet by drivers, as reasonably directed by the Participant.

  • Pre-Closing Deliveries (i) At least ten Business Days prior to the Closing, the Seller will furnish to the Buyer a certificate (the “Estimated Purchase Price Certificate”) setting forth (i) a good faith estimate of the Closing Net Working Capital; (ii) the Estimated Indebtedness (including Paid Indebtedness); (iii) the estimated Seller’s Expenses that remain unpaid as of the Closing; (iv) a good faith estimate of the Company Cash; and (v) a reasonably detailed calculation of the Purchase Price using the Company’s good faith calculation of the foregoing estimates and other amounts (the “Estimated Purchase Price”). The Estimated Purchase Price Certificate will be prepared in accordance with the Calculation Principles, and will not include any changes in assets or liabilities as a result of purchase accounting adjustments arising from, or resulting as a consequence of, the Transactions. The Seller shall (x) provide supporting documentation as may be reasonably requested by the Buyer in order to allow it to review the calculations set forth in the Estimated Purchase Price Certificate, and (y) make appropriate revisions to the Estimated Purchase Price Certificate as are mutually agreed upon by the Seller and the Buyer acting in good faith; provided that if the parties cannot mutually agree upon any proposed revisions to the Estimated Purchase Price Certificate, then, the parties shall use estimates set forth in the Estimated Purchase Price Certificate as prepared by the Seller for Closing, and the Buyer may thereafter seek adjustments pursuant to the remaining provisions of this Section 1.8; and
